Atlantic Theater Company continues its 2018-2019 season with the New York premiere of Nomad Motel, written by Carla Ching and directed by Ed Sylvanus Iskandar.

In the not-so-sunny side of California, Alix bounces between motel rooms, taking care of her brothers for her mostly MIA mother. Her classmate Mason is a budding songwriter trying to keep off the radar of his absent father in Hong Kong. Together, they must learn to scrape by without giving up their dreams. Nomad Motel is a surprising tale of kids raising themselves and making something out of nothing in the land of plenty.
